Planning and implementation of a clinical trial to include but not limited to coordination with all members/ departments/ external institutions of the study team, oversight of IRB, regulatory and /or FDA submissions, budget preparation participation, and study management tool development Provide education and training to other health care professionals related to patient participation in a clinical trial.
Ongoing oversight of several projects' IRB and Regulatory management.
Screening, recruitment, and enrollment of study participants. Procure eligibility data and materials, interface with sponsors as appropriate in determining eligibility.
Collaborates with the PI in the case management of protocol patients; assuring compliance with the protocol and regulatory requirements and patient billing compliance
Oversee study lab specimen collection, processing and shipping
Collecting, recording and maintaining accurate data.
Oversee coordination of long term data collection
Manage queries
Prepare and participate in Cooperative Group Audits, NCI, FDA, Sponsor GCP quality audits, Loyola internal audits and department audits.
Participation in program research planning to include as appropriate, protocol development, data reporting and grant reporting.
Participate in Departmental Process Improvement Activities, National Committees as appropriate
Establish thorough knowledge base of assigned trials in order to coordinate the care of the protocol patients through the medical center encounters
Nursing assessment skills
Patient and family education related to the trial
Triage of calls from assigned protocol patients
Provides timely feedback to principal investigators and local physician caring for patient
Monitoring of patients as defined by protocol
Provide timely information to all regulatory bodies as required by protocol with particular attention to patient toxicities.
Establish and maintain effective collaborative communications with Cancer Center Care Team as well as other multidisciplinary bodies on campus
Project management of multiple projects with varied critical time demands
